Types of Laser Rotaries: Chuck and Roller Styles
There are two styles of laser rotaries: Chuck and Roller styles. The PiBurn Grip 2 is a chuck-style rotary, while the PiBurn V is a roller. The PiBurn Omni 2 is Both!

Roller rotaries rely on friction to spin your object. To increase the friction between your cup and the motorized wheel, the PiBurn V uses an innovative clamp. It works great for most items and is very easy to operate.

Pros and Cons of Each Style
PiBurn V (Roller Style)
✓ PRO
Ideal for simple straight tumblers, large batches, and beginners. Easy to use with the option to add the Grip 2 later, giving you the OMNI.
✗ CON
May slip with heavy-handled items. Cannot frame at high speeds or use the scoring method. Full wraps can be tricky.
PiBurn Grip 2 (Chuck Style)
✓ PRO
Perfect for odd-shaped items like pens, rings, and dog bowls. Precision no-slip engraving, full wraps, scoring, and many interchangeable jaw types.
✗ CON
More of a learning curve to master. Complex system with interchangeable jaws and moving parts. Adjustments take more time than the PiBurn V.
PiBurn Omni 2 (Chuck + Roller)
✓ PRO
Both roller and chuck systems with two dedicated motors. Essentially two rotaries in one, giving your business a built-in backup.
✗ CON
Fairly heavy and bulky for smaller laser machines. Has a larger footprint than other rotaries.
